Elaine Ryan Hedges (August 18, 1927 – June 5, 1997) was an American feminist who pioneered Women's Studies in the 1970s and advocated for curricula encompassing a more inclusive body of American literature which brought together works by ethnic and gendered minorities. A recognized expert in feminist literary criticism, she was awarded The Feminist Press Award for Contributions to Women's Culture in 1988 and inducted into the Maryland Women's Hall of Fame in 1998.
